How they compare
Turkmenistan currently reports 0.0623 units per square kilometre against 0.0616 units per square kilometre in South Sudan, a difference of 0.0007 units per square kilometre.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 12 shared years of data; in 2012 it was South Sudan ahead.
South Sudan ranks 202nd and Turkmenistan ranks 201st of 215 countries.
South Sudan has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
